The Museum takes part in Nocturne Halifax to explore this year’s theme, “Nomadic Reciprocity” through the lens of immigration. Begin your Nocturne tour at the Museum this year and discover these inspiring artists and stunning creations:
Nocturne Beacon Project artists Alan Syliboy and Lukas Pearse present an outdoor projection mapping piece combining Mi’kmaq art with technologically driven video art.
Mocean Dance and Hear Here Productions present Burnwater: Arrival, an interactive performance and installation that explores the connections between place, memory and the natural world.
Marla Benton presents The Reflection Room, a hands-on activity for participants to take home an art piece and leave a memory behind.
Justin Buckley and Eskasoni Cultural Journeys present Wind Stories, collaborating Mi’kmaq storytellers with software-generated sound art to interpret the wind.
